Summary
The unicode character "䇚" at code point U+41DA is a CJK (Chinese Japanese Korean) ideogram meaning "(same as U+6534 攴) to tap, to rap, (same as U+64B2 撲) to pat, to beat, to strike, to dash, or to smash". It is a character in the CJK Unified Ideographs Extension A block and is part of the Han script. The character is an other letter. The UTF-8 encoding of "䇚" is 0xE4 0x87 0x9A and the UTF-16 encoding is 0x41DA.
